I studied media art and dance in Canada and fine art in London, UK. Although I have been influenced by Western cultures, I pursue the natural world of matter, beyond all those cultural frames, in finding my sense of self and, thus, in making art. Improvisation then became my method for art.āØ
My artist residency at Yatoo in South Korea, in 2015 and 2016, greatly influenced my art from this perspective. Their theme, Nature art, focused on the relationship between humans and nature. They advise artists to enter nature without preconceptions and allow themselves to be transformed in encounters with nature, while minimizing human interruptions. This philosophy regarding the relationship between nature and art (or artists) became the foundation of my art practice.
I mainly use bodily movement to practice improvisation, but I also employ my knowledge of visual art and media art. I have been making site-specific improvised performance since 2015. Since then, I have gradually been incorporating sound art in my performances, in relation to the concepts of movement and space. I am also starting to explore the form of dance theatre, using sound within an improvised theatrical setting. I explore ways to use sound as a vehicle for understanding bodily performance through the concept of space, both natural and conceptual. āØ
I also make DIY printmaking, employing the same principles of improvisation that I use for my performance work. I often use recycles as plates and plant based ink available in the kitchen or nature.
